The open, bright and contemporary new lobby at the hotel in South San Francisco welcomes guests with vivid contrasting colors, including blue, green, orange and red. The traditional front desk is replaced with separate welcome pedestals to create more personal and private interactions when guests check in.
Guests can also start relaxing right away thanks to new flexible seating options. This hotel near the San Francisco Airport installed a communal table, private media booths with high-definition televisions, and a semi-enclosed lounge area.

A signature element of the new lobby is the exclusive GoBoard® technology. Unique among San Francisco Airport hotels, the 52-inch LCD touch screen is packed with local information, maps, weather, and news, business and sports headlines. Guests can navigate using the touch screen to find restaurants, local attractions and directions.

Guests can connect to free Wi-Fi while charging their gadgets thanks to newly installed outlets in the lobby area. The enlarged business library offers even more space to work in and features several complimentary computer terminals along with a free printer and separate computer stations dedicated to printing airline boarding passes and checking flight status.

Guests at this South San Francisco hotel can also keep their stomachs happy with a new dining concept. The completely redesigned Bistro – Eat. Drink. Connect. Offers casual, flexible seating; easier access to food and higher quality, healthier menu options for breakfast; and light evening fare, including snacks, wine and beer so guests can unwind. The MarketTM, a 24/7 shop for snacks, beverages and sundries, is always open for late-night cravings or the toothpaste you forgot to pack.
